Go Backend Developer

Vancouver, WA

$140K - $180K/yr

Full-time

Medical, Dental, Vision, Life, Retirement, PTO

Re-posted 24 days ago


Job description

Impact Scale LLC is seeking an experienced, performance-driven Backend Engineer (Go) to help build, refine, and scale our next-generation, real-time performance management platform. Joining a small, elite engineering team, you will collaborate with fellow senior engineers to deliver mission-critical platform capabilities, engineer high-throughput backend services, and continuously push the boundaries of platform concurrency and reliability.
This role is ideal for a systems-minded engineer who takes deep ownership of their architectural footprint, writes highly optimized code, and thrives when dealing with the challenges of massive real-time data ingestion. You will play a vital role in building fault-tolerant infrastructure capable of processing large volumes of live data with absolute stability.
Key Responsibilities

Backend Go Engineering API Architecture

  • Service Development: Design, build, and deploy high-performance backend features and standalone microservices using Go (Golang).

  • API Integration Engine: Build, document, and maintain ultra-reliable REST APIs and complex integrations with external data partners and programmatic networks.

  • Clean Code Standards: Write exceptionally clean, well-tested (unit/integration tests), and easily maintainable code structured for long-term scalability.

  • Peer Governance: Participate in technical peer code reviews and contribute to the continuous refinement of internal coding guardrails and deployment processes.

Event-Driven Microservices Concurrency Scaling

  • Event-Driven Implementation: Architecture and launch new decoupled capabilities within a distributed, event-driven microservices platform.

  • Message Broker Management: Configure and scale message brokers and event streaming lines (specifically NATS, Kafka, or RabbitMQ).

  • Concurrency Optimization: Apply deep knowledge of Go routines, channels, asynchronous processing, and memory allocation to eliminate system bottlenecks.

  • Database Optimization: Design schemas and optimize heavy read/write transactional operations utilizing PostgreSQLand Rediscaching layers.

Containerization Technical Workflows

  • Containerized Ecosystems: Develop, test, and containerize modular backend applications utilizing Dockerwithin staging and production infrastructure.

  • Version Control Operations: Manage complex code branches, continuous system integration pipelines, and release environments utilizing Git.


Qualifications Skills

Required

  • Experience Depth: 4+ years of professional backend software development experience explicitly engineering applications in Go (Golang).

  • API Fluency: Proven history of building robust REST APIs and handling complex third-party system data integrations.

  • Architectural Literacy: Demonstrated experience working inside distributed microservice environments and utilizing heavy message brokers.

  • Data Layer Stack: Hands-on operational experience building and tuning storage solutions with PostgreSQL and Redis.

  • Core Attributes: Native grasp of concurrent programming concepts, an aggressive execution bias, high accountability, and an exceptional ability to solve ambiguous technical scaling problems.
